Special Olympics


There are nine official sports at the State Special Olympic Games - Aquatics, Athletics (Track & Field), Bocce, Bowling, Golf, Horseshoes, Powerlifting, 3-on-3 Basketball, Volleyball, and Softball. Two additional programs offered will be Motor Activities (Wheelchair Sports) training program & "Stars of the Future" for children under eight.

Athletes must train a minimum of 8 weeks in a sport, and compete at the area/sectional level prior to gaining eligibility to compete at the state level for Winter Games (January in Norman), and Summer Games (May in Stillwater).
